DMX is mad as Hell at Drake -- and it's over an angel. X revealed his beef with Drizzy doesn't just rest on what he feels is Drake's "annoying" raps, but also the fact that the Canadian-born MC took the reins on a posthumous Aaliyah record without collaborating with anyone else the late songbird worked with.

In his music, Drake often raps about his humble beginnings while growing up in his hometown of Toronto. But some critics have questioned Drizzy’s authenticity when it comes to his upbringing since he was raised primarily in an upper middle-class neighborhood. Drake scoffs at any notion that he grew up as a rich kid.
